Get in Touch** The Nissan repair market in Sharon, Pennsylvania, and its immediate vicinity (Hermitage) is characterized by a clear hierarchy. The authorized dealership, #1 Cochran Nissan, represents the top tier for factory-specified repairs, warranty work, and access to OEM parts and training. The independent market is robust but not saturated with Nissan-specific specialists. Instead, several high-quality, general import mechanics have established excellent reputations for Nissan work, particularly for out-of-warranty vehicles where cost-effectiveness becomes a major factor. Competition is healthy, driving a focus on customer service. Pricing follows a predictable structure: dealership labor rates are at a premium, while independent shops offer significant savings, often 20-30% lower, on labor while using high-quality aftermarket or OEM parts. For highly specialized services like in-depth GT-R maintenance or complex AWD/ATTESA system repairs, owners may need to travel to major metropolitan centers like Pittsburgh or Cleveland, as the local expertise for these niche areas is limited. Overall, Sharon residents have access to competent and reputable Nissan service options for the vast majority of their needs.

In Sharon, common issues include CVT transmission concerns, especially with models like the Altima and Rogue, exacerbated by stop-and-go traffic on routes like State Street or I-80. Additionally, rust prevention and brake system checks are vital due to our region's winter road salt and humid summers, which accelerate corrosion.
Look for shops with certified Nissan or ASE technicians, such as those with "Nissan Master Technician" credentials. Check reviews for local shops focusing on consistent communication and fair pricing, and consider asking for recommendations in local community groups like "Sharon, PA Now" on Facebook for firsthand experiences.
Seek a local independent specialist for routine maintenance, older model repairs, or after-warranty work to often save on labor rates. For complex computer/ECM issues, newer model recalls, or warranty-covered repairs, the authorized dealerships in nearby Hermitage or Youngstown may be necessary for specific software and genuine parts.
Labor rates in Sharon are typically more competitive than in major metropolitan areas, potentially lowering overall costs. However, parts availability for less common models might sometimes cause slight delays, so it's wise to ask about part sourcing timelines when getting an estimate from your local shop.
Sharon's pothole-prone roads after winter freeze-thaw cycles demand more frequent alignment and tire checks. Furthermore, the seasonal extremes—from hot, humid summers to harsh, salty winters—mean your cooling system and undercarriage should be inspected more often than the manual's standard schedule suggests.
